Testing of Woven Wire Cloth according to ISO 9044

Determination of the wire diameter The wire diameter after weaving may be determined by using one of the following procedures:1.)by measuring wires which have been loosened fromthe woven wire cloth (e.g. by using a micrometer screw),2.)by measuring the wires in the cloth, if there is suffi-cient space for the measuring instrument.The tolerance of the wire before weaving can no longerbe determined in the woven wire cloth, because of its heavy deformation during weaving. The nominal wire diameter, however, can be calculated using the empirical weight formula. Aperture width (Measuring row method) In this simplified method, the number of pitches (p) in a given length (L) is determined. The given length is then divided by the number of pitches to give the average pitch. Subtraction of the wire diameter (d) from the average pitch then gives the aperture width (w).Todetermine the arithmetical mean value of the aperturewidths, as many pitches have to be measured as are nec- essary to obtain a representative value.When measuring aperture widths between 16 and 1 mm10 pitches have to be checked; smaller aperture widths – up to 0.1 mm – should be checked within 20 pitches.

Required Details forWire Cloth Orders

1.Quantity: number of pieces or rolls2.Dimensions: length and width or rolls 3.Material 4.Aperture width: wMesh count (per linear inch)or number of meshes per cm
2 may likewise be stated instead of the aperturewidth.5.Wire diameter: d6.Type of weave – if necessary 7.Post weaving processing – if desired 08.Shaped parts or filters:provide samples, sketches ordrawings, preferably with permissible tolerances.09.Samples: should you have a sample of the wire clothused previously, kindly send it to us. We shall then analyze the specification.10.Repeat orders: so as to furnish you with the correctmaterial either let us have a roll-label or provide the exact technical data of the previous order. 3
